**Your Key Responsibilities**

Primary Tasks, working under the supervision of Project Managers and Senior Biologists:

- Conduct background reviews for natural heritage assessments
- Undertake field work using Stantec’s Standard Operating Procedures and industry standard protocols, including inventory and assessment of:

- Wildlife and wildlife habitat
- Flora and vegetation communities
- Species at risk and other species of conservation concern
- Determining the effectiveness of mitigation efforts for species at risk or other sensitive species or features in Ontario during construction projects
- Enter, compile, and analyze field data
- Prepare reports, including natural heritage input to a variety of planning projects such as species at risk assessments, environmental assessments, environmental impact studies, and ecological monitoring
- Occasionally travel for work, including field work in remote locations, which may require intense travel during the field season and on weekends
- Participate in Stantec’s Health, Safety, Security and Environment (HSSE) policies, procedures, standards and guidelines in the execution of all work
- Occasional Tasks may include:
+ Participate in field sampling for fish, benthic macroinvertebrates, sediment and water quality

+ Conduct aquatic and habitat assessments for fisheries.

**Qualifications**

**Your Capabilities and Credentials**
- Species identification expertise (e.g., trees and other plants, herptiles, birds)
- Valid Class G driver’s license
- Enthusiasm for working in field and office settings
- Ability to work well within a team environment
- Independent problem-solving abilities, and able to adapt to a changing work schedule
- Excellent technical writing and oral communication skills
- Organization and time management skills
- The following would be considered assets:
+ Previous environmental consulting experience

+ Previous experience conducting surveys for species at risk in Ontario

+ Previous experience supporting environmental assessments and permitting

+ Butternut Health Assessor certification

+ Backpack electrofishing certification and other fisheries experience.

**Education and Experience**
- A Bachelor’s degree in Biology or technical diploma in a related field is required as a minimum
- Minimum of 1 year of professional experience as a terrestrial ecologist in Ontario
